East Coast Monster Storm Risk Next Week
<http://www.accuweather.com/en/weather-news/midatlantic-snowstorm-potentia/7088979>

A wintry system that will make a cross-country tour beginning this
weekend has the potential to develop into a powerful, damaging and
very disruptive storm along the East Coast next week.

East Coast
Once the storm reaches the Atlantic coast Wednesday into Thursday
(March 6-7), conditions at most levels in the nearby atmosphere and
well away from the storm throughout North America will favor explosive
development. At this point, the storm could become a real monster.
While being too cold and stopping shy of becoming a tropical system,
it could pack the punch like one with serious impacts to lives,
property and travel plans....
